Transaction 89a8f25ed0633ce72f6ac84daad79b533951578f43f0e6b1821fc94401027d8b
1 Input
1 Output
-
89a8f25ed0633ce72f6ac84daad79b533951578f43f0e6b1821fc94401027d8b:0
- value
- 1155540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e652da92543e66c7a0ec97198f842bbe5914c6bc OP_EQUAL
- address
- 3NgrbSuDACPLPEZu6TSEuryb8SrqXwTksy